Severe Electrical Issue, Lots of things not working!

Things not working, (no power at all):
Stereo
Dome Lights
Door locks (both from key and the inside switches)


Things that super confuse me:
When the key is turned to accessory position (not on) nothing even lights up!
When the key is fully on, then the switch on the door to lock/unlock works ????????

Things that happend:
I had my middle dome light that was out, so i thought it was a fuse, i went ahead into the fuse box, and got my plyers
I went for the fuse (if i can recal, fuse #9) and before i even was able to pull it, a spark flew!! Then another. tiny sparks, but enough to worry me
I think this might of been caused by my plyers resting on the metal frame before the fusebox, when touching the fuse

The interesting part that happend is, the fuse did not blow.
But this is when hell broke lose. Nothing was working now
Then all those problems came, now all the dome lights are out, radio doesnt have NO power, and key issue is still happeneing

Took it to the dealer, since I have an aftermarket radio, they wont even touch it under warrenty, want 100$ for first hour and $150 each hour after
Took it to a mechanic, had him check all the fuses. all are good. I even swapped a lot of them. Nothing

Could the dealer be right, and it has to be something with the radio instaall (which was installed a year ago), but didnt trigger anything bad untill i tried puling a fuse??

issue fixed. was a fuse under the hood that blew, even tho i didnt touch it, the 30amp one i think, that has the fuse holder resting on it
